使企业应用程序无法卸载

时间:2015-03-10 14:23:58

标签: android root

我正在为我的客户开发一个企业应用程序。他让Companys手机扎根,但他需要一个可以控制背景的应用程序。但问题是,他不想要这样的应用程序可以卸载。我知道你可以让应用程序成为系统应用程序,但它仍然可以被停用..你也可以使用设备管理员,但它可以只是取消注册,然后卸载..任何方式使应用程序可以卸载?当然,该应用程序只会安装在Companys手机上,而不是谷歌播放。问你是否不理解我的问题...... :-)

1 个答案:

答案 0 :(得分:0)

根据设备制造商的不同,这可能是可能的。我最熟悉三星设备。

在三星设备上,有一个名为Knox的特殊SDK,它有许多有用的API。其中一个允许您为您选择的任何应用程序禁用卸载。即便如此,仍然可以通过恢复出厂设置删除应用程序(但Knox也可以禁用出厂重置)。

如果您不在三星,那么您使用的任何制造商都可能拥有类似的SDK,因此您应该对其进行调查。如果你在三星,你需要访问Knox SDK,这不是免费的,但既然你说这是给客户的,那么他愿意付钱吗?